Data capture in accounting is the process of extracting financial information from documents and converting it into a usable digital format for accounting systems.
Instead of manually typing invoice details, GST values, ledger information, or voucher entries into software like Tally, modern data capture systems automatically identify and process the information from:
The captured data can then be validated and transferred directly into accounting workflows.
For accounting teams, this helps reduce repetitive entry work while improving processing speed and accuracy.
Many accounting firms and finance teams still rely heavily on manual workflows.
But transaction volumes continue increasing every year.
A single accountant may process hundreds of invoices, GST documents, purchase records, and bank transactions within limited timelines.
In high-volume accounting environments, manual entry often creates operational bottlenecks.
1. Higher Chances of Human Errors - Even small mistakes in invoice numbers, GSTIN details, tax values, or ledger selection can create reconciliation issues later.
2. Repetitive Operational Work - Accounting teams spend significant time handling repetitive data entry instead of focusing on reporting, analysis, or client advisory tasks.
3. Delayed Processing - Manual workflows slow down bookkeeping, reconciliation, and monthly closing activities.
4. Increased Pressure During GST Filing Periods - GST return periods usually involve processing large volumes of invoices within short timelines, increasing workload pressure on accounting teams.
5. Dependency on Manual Validation - Many finance workflows still depend on employees manually verifying and entering data from multiple documents.

Modern data capture systems combine multiple technologies to improve accounting efficiency and accuracy.
Optical Character Recognition (OCR)
OCR helps extract text from PDFs, scanned invoices, printed bills, and financial documents. In accounting workflows, it is commonly used to capture invoice numbers, GST details, tax amounts, vendor names, and ledger information automatically instead of manual typing.
Intelligent Character Recognition (ICR)
ICR extends OCR by identifying handwritten text from bills, notes, and physical accounting documents. This becomes useful while processing older records or handwritten financial entries.
Artificial Intelligence (AI)
AI helps systems understand invoice structures, identify accounting fields, and improve extraction accuracy over time. It can automatically recognize vendor formats, detect missing information, and reduce manual correction efforts, specially when businesses receive invoices in different layouts.
Machine Learning
Machine learning enables systems to improve continuously as more accounting documents are processed. Over time, the system becomes better at understanding invoice patterns and processing financial data more accurately.
Robotic Process Automation (RPA)
